Java基础:数据类型、运算符与控制语句详解

需积分: 9 1 下载量 90 浏览量 更新于2024-08-18 收藏 1.58MB PPT 举报
Java程序设计是计算机编程的基础,本讲聚焦于Java的基本语法,由王伟老师主讲,隶属于河北师范大学软件学院Java课程组。教学目标包括理解并掌握Java的关键概念,如数据类型、变量与常量、运算符及其优先级,以及各种控制语句。这些内容是程序员入门的必备知识。 首先,Java程序中的数据类型和变量至关重要。数据类型定义了内存中存储数据的不同形式,例如整型(int)、浮点型(float)、字符型(char)等。变量则是用于存储数据的容器,它们有特定的名称(变量名),例如可以使用字母、下划线或美元符号(如`money`, `score`, `name`, `sex`),但必须遵循一定的命名规则,首字母小写,后面单词首字母大写,如`myScore`。 变量名的选择需要清晰地反映其用途,以便其他开发者能够快速理解。内存分配是按照数据类型的要求为变量申请合适的存储空间,就像旅馆中根据需求选择不同类型的房间(单人间、双人间或总统套房)。在Java中,每个变量都有其独特的内存地址,不同变量存储在不同的地址,确保数据间的独立性和安全性。 运算符是编程中的核心元素,包括算术运算符(如加减乘除)、关系运算符(如等于、不等于)和逻辑运算符(如与、或、非)。运算符的优先级决定了表达式的执行顺序,了解并正确使用运算符有助于编写高效、易读的代码。 控制语句如条件语句(if-else)、循环语句(for, while)和跳转语句(break, continue)允许程序根据条件执行不同的代码路径,实现程序的逻辑流程控制。 在实际应用中,程序员不仅要将数据存入内存,还要能够通过变量名(类似房间的名字)找到数据,以及判断是否可以修改(如查看房间是否已入住,能否调整存款利率)。理解内存的工作原理,如如何计算变化后的值(如银行利息问题),对理解程序运行机制至关重要。 总结来说,本讲内容涵盖了Java基础的各个方面,从数据类型和变量到内存管理、运算符和控制结构,为初学者提供了一个扎实的编程基础框架。掌握这些内容,是踏上专业Java编程之路的重要一步。